报告题目:Interacting Particle Systems for Optimization: from Particle Swarm Optimization to Consensus-Based Optimization

报告摘要: In this talk, we introduce applications of metaheuristics through extensive systems of interacting particles to address complex optimization problems, beginning with the Particle Swarm Optimization (PSO) method. This technique leverages collective intelligence, where individual particles adjust their trajectories based on their own performance and the influence of neighbouring particles, guiding the swarm toward an optimal solution. We shall investigate the continuous model proposed by Grassi and Pareschi, demonstrating its convergence to global minimizers and highlighting its connection to Consensus-Based Optimization (CBO) in the zero-inertia limit. This presentation is based on joint works with Cristina Cipriani, Hui Huang, and Konstantin Riedl.



报告人简介:Dr. Jinniao Qiu is an associate professor in the Department of Mathematics and Statistics, University of Calgary. He received his Ph.D. from the School of Mathematical Sciences, Fudan University, in 2012. After that, he was a postdoctoral fellow in Humboldt-University Berlin first and then a limited-term assistant professor in the University of Michigan. In 2017, he joined the University of Calgary. The research interests include stochastic control, games, and optimizations, (stochastic) PDEs, mathematical finance and economics, and nonlinear dynamical systems.
